Husband sentenced for using ‘splitting maul’ ax to kill wife

A husband and father in Texas is heading to prison for murdering his wife with a “splitting maul” ax as their daughter listened to them fighting “next door,” according to prosecutors.

Craig Smith, 41, was sentenced Wednesday to 50 years in prison for the February 2024 killing of Vennessa Smith, 42. She was found “lying in blood in her bed with multiple large lacerations” to the upper parts of her body” on Feb. 26, according to the Upshur County Criminal District Attorney’s Office.
